About Kearny

Kearny is a small town in central Arizona with an estimated population of 1,898.

Kearny holds the status of an incorporated town — local government on a neighborly scale. The community covers 2.7 square miles, giving it a balanced suburban layout with room to breathe at roughly 703 residents per square mile.
